· Recording Observations – the following data to be listed for every observation:
Observer – name Object (target) Date – DD.MM.YY Time (GMT – NOT BST) Instrument used (Naked Eeye, binoculars, telescope – if an instrument, give as much detail about the specific instrument as possible) Location of observation – Latitude, Longitude Weather conditions Seeing conditions (use the Antoniadi scale Position of object in sky (approx Altitude and Azimuth) Observing Notes – record here anything else that you think is relevant
